Chilly Start for Royals Against the Twins​

Hey fellow Royals fans! Well, it wasn't the game we were hoping for today, as the Kansas City Royals fell to the Minnesota Twins 4-0. Both teams got off to a slow start, with both sides putting up zeroes on the scoreboard through the first three innings. Jonathan India and Bobby Witt Jr. had a tough time kick-starting our offense in the early innings.

Middle Innings Make the Difference​

It was a challenging stretch starting in the 4th inning when the Twins broke through. After a walk to Carlos Correa, Edouard Julien singled, driving Correa home to give the Twins their first run. Bobby Witt Jr. managed to hit a double in the bottom of the fourth, but a double play ended our hopes of scoring. The Twins added to their lead in the sixth and kept us in check offensively.

Twins Seal the Victory​

The 8th inning was a tough one as Matt Wallner extended the Twins' lead with a solo home run. Meanwhile, our guys weren't able to get much going, save for a single by Cavan Biggio. In the 9th, Ty France put the game further out of reach with a home run just to make things worse. Bobby Witt Jr. tried to ignite a last-minute rally with a walk in the final inning, but it wasn't enough.
